akaGM
Platinum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ору KChernov Цитата: Фортран не умеет объявлять переменные не в самом начале | типа for(int i=0; i<N; i++) {} или do_something(); { int i; do_something2(); } ... ? но ведь именно из-за Цитата: Фортран не умеет объявлять переменные не в самом начале | надо быть реалистами и на моё ХО следует держать всё под контролем: инициализировать, описывать типы, не полагаться на авто-конверсию, на всякие сборщики мусора, и тд, т.е. Цитата: это как раз [мой] лучший стиль программирования! | остальное же я называю визуальным стилем программированием для домработниц а что касается Цитата: А что насчёт цикла - в этом смысле он должен быть с постусловием без вариантов. | так в Ф нет его, с постусловием... менее нагляден (отсюда и вопрос об 666)? -- согласен только что можно требовать от услуги имени нашего президента, которую я оказываю ленивому студенту? ладно, пусть будет так: Код: result = 0.0 rest = 1. - 1./3. do while (rest .gt. eps) result = result + rest rest = 1.0/float(3**exponent) exponent = exponent + 1 numIter = numIter + 1 enddo | | Всего записей: 24613 | Зарегистр. 06-12-2002 | Отправлено: 21:35 11-11-2009 | Исправлено: akaGM, 11:54 12-11-2009 |
|